HOLY OF HOLIES. The temple’s central and largest room featured a tall standing stone (massebah), seen here on the right, and an elevated offering table on the left. The standing stone was likely an aniconic representation of the temple’s chief deity, and the offering table would have served as a place for priests to lay out offerings or perform rituals such as pouring libations and burning incense. The floor of the room was scattered with a wide variety of cultic artifacts including vessels of various types, mortars and pestles, and incense burners.
